The American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) now recommends exome or genome sequencing as first-tier testing for patients with global developmental delay and intellectual disability (GDD/ID) when a specific diagnosis isn’t suspected. Here’s what this could mean for your practice: ✅ Reduces time to diagnosis ✅ Enables more targeted and timely interventions ✅ Informs care plans with greater precision ✅ Minimizes unnecessary or redundant testing This shift empowers providers to move from uncertainty to clarity, so families get the answers they need, sooner.
